American bombers from Italy struck again
yesterday at oil targets in Austria and Hungary.
8th Army troops are pressing the Germans
hard as they fall back between Florence and
the Adriatic to the main Gothic Line
positions. On leaving Italy Mr. Churchill
has sent a message to the Italian people.
He tells them that hard fighting lies ahead
and announces that large Italian
forces will soon be joining the Allies.
The Russians have captured three more
Danube ports in Romania and have
forced their way through one of the Carpathian
passes into Transylvania.
A Bulgarian report says the Germans
have begun to withdraw from Bulgaria.
In the South West Pacific Allied aircraft
have destroyed or damaged 8 more Japanese
merchant vessels off Celebes.
RAF Mosquitoes attacked Essen last night.
Before dark heavy bombers attacked
flying bomb sites in Northern France.
More flying bombs came over this country
yesterday. The public are officially warned
against expecting an early end to the attacks
